Strains of Ba'athism are very similar to fascist ideology and absolutely have a grand imperialist design. Ba'athists want a pan-arab totalitarian political entity to create a new era of arabic political and cultural supremacy. Combine that with Saddamism's focus on Iraqi nationalism and militarism and you have an ideology closely resembling the European fascism of the 30's and 40's.
